Relatives of Anand Jon say justice denied
Updated on Mar 17, 2009 09:00 pm IST
Relatives of Fashion Designer Anand Jon, convicted of sexually assaulting budding models, sought Indian government's intervention on Monday, saying that Jon was denied justice in the US. Jon's mother and sister are in India to drum up support for the 'Free Anand Jon' campaign before a crucial April 1 hearing at a Los Angeles court on defence arguments that he deserves a re-trial on the grounds of prosecutorial and juror misconduct.
